How Reliable is the Toyota Yaris?

Based on 9,038,234 MOT tests across 631,037 vehicles.

77.7%
Pass Rate
4,759
Miles/Year
27
Year Lifespan
631,037
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 149,812
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 133,602
position lamp(s) not working 65,683
Stop lamp not working 58,922
Brake pipe excessively corroded 52,660

X867 BGR is a 2001 Toyota Yaris in Beige with a 1,299c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.

Across all 2001 Toyota Yaris models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.7% with a typical mileage of 69,035 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Toyota Yaris f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 149,812 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X867 BGR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Toyota Yaris typ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 25 years old, this Toyota Yaris is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
